X-FIles was one of those shows that seemed like I would like it, had all the ingredients I usually like, but it never really worked for me. The stand-alone eps were alright, but that mythology of the show was so convoluted and ridiculous that I gave up. I remember years after it was off the air, I watched the final ep on Sci Fi just to see if the conspiracy was finally explained. And it was, Scully explained it in detail complete with flashbacks on the witness stand, and even as she was laying it all out, IT WAS STILL IMPOSSIBLE TO FOLLOW! I consider that a show with great potential that got mired down in its own seriousness and became a mess.
